forum.bitel.ru http://forum.bitel.ru/ |
|
Вопрос по сертификатам http://forum.bitel.ru/viewtopic.php?f=22&t=1590 |
Страница 1 из 1 |
Автор: | mrustik [ 10 ноя 2008, 12:01 ] |
Заголовок сообщения: | Вопрос по сертификатам |
Начал настраивать платежи ч/з ОСНП, и вычитал в ветке http://www.bgbilling.ru/forum/viewtopic.php?t=124 Цитата: пароль к хранилищу и закрытому ключу (оба одинаковые, значение keystore.password в конфиге биллинга) В документации описание такого параметра нигде не нашел. В настройках поставил, изменил сертификаты сервера, хотя в доке написано Цитата: Далее приводиться текст выводимый при запуске и соответственно вводимый текст вы можете вводить что хотите за исключением пароля его надо ввести именно такой bgbilling поставил свой. Что-то изменится в работе системы или нет. Если сделал все правильно, то в доке это нужно отразить.
|
Автор: | mrustik [ 10 ноя 2008, 12:17 ] |
Заголовок сообщения: | |
С другим паролем биллинг перестал работать. Как поставить свой пароль к хранилищу и закрытому ключу |
Автор: | and [ 10 ноя 2008, 12:45 ] |
Заголовок сообщения: | |
mrustik писал(а): С другим паролем биллинг перестал работать. Как поставить свой пароль к хранилищу и закрытому ключу http://www.bgbilling.ru/v4.5/doc/ch01s12.html Цитата: Далее приводиться текст выводимый при запуске и соответственно вводимый текст вы можете вводить что хотите за исключением пароля его надо ввести именно такой bgbilling.
|
Автор: | Amir [ 10 ноя 2008, 14:22 ] |
Заголовок сообщения: | |
Параметр конфига сервера (не конфига модуля) keystore.password должен совпадать с паролем к хранилищу и закрытому ключу. По умолчанию он - bgbilling. |
Автор: | mrustik [ 10 ноя 2008, 20:23 ] |
Заголовок сообщения: | |
А где в доке про этот параметр написано, я в конфиге сервера и ставил. Но все перестало работать, в логах было, что не знаю пароль. |
Автор: | mrustik [ 12 ноя 2008, 17:32 ] |
Заголовок сообщения: | |
А в версии 4.4 этот параметр keystore.password есть ![]() |
Автор: | mrustik [ 14 ноя 2008, 10:21 ] |
Заголовок сообщения: | |
В конфигурации сервера стоит параметр keystore.password, правда последней строкой. Пароль к самому хранилищу и закрытому ключу стандартный, как сервер получает к нему доступ ??????????????? |
Автор: | Amir [ 14 ноя 2008, 19:14 ] |
Заголовок сообщения: | |
хранилище используется для порта https. при старте сервера он пытается открыть хранилище, используя пароль из конфига keystore.password, если в конфиге нет, то использует пароль bgbilling |
Автор: | mrustik [ 17 ноя 2008, 09:08 ] | ||
Заголовок сообщения: | |||
Вы меня конечно извините, но как это объяснить, если пароль стоит 1234567 в конфиге, а на хранилище bgbilling, и все работает?????????
|
Автор: | Amir [ 17 ноя 2008, 11:53 ] |
Заголовок сообщения: | |
Цитата: at bitel.billing.server.Server.<init>(Server.java:353)
at bitel.billing.server.Server.main(Server.java:199) Caused by: java.security.UnrecoverableKeyException: Password verification failed at sun.security.provider.JavaKeyStore.engineLoad(JavaKeyStore.java:769) Ниже в конфиге нет переназначения параметра keystore.password? Конфиг активный? Хранилище - файл .keystore и у него точно пароль bgbilling? Сервер точно перезапускается? Если у вас стоит JDK, то в директории биллинга выполните keytool -list -keystore .keystore -storepass bgbilling |
Автор: | mrustik [ 18 ноя 2008, 09:01 ] |
Заголовок сообщения: | |
1. Конфиг едиственный Код: #режим выдачи страниц: xml либо html - сборка страниц браузером либо на сервере
web.mode=html web.admin.password=XXXXXXXXXXXXXXXXXXXXXXX #в режиме xml по этому пути браузер будет получать xls web.xslt=http://x.y.z.f:8080/bgbilling/xsl/ #в режиме xml при обращении через порт https по этому пути браузер будет получать xls web.xslt.https=https://x.y.z.f:8443/bgbilling/xsl/ #пароль к хранилищу и закрытому ключу keystore.password =1234567 #XSLT шаблон для печати баланса contract.xslt=contract_balance_print.xsl #путь, по которому сервер будет искать XSLT файлы server.xslt=http://x.y.z.f:8080/bgbilling/xsl/ #настройки почты mail.smtp.host=aaaaa.zzzzzzzz.ru mail.from.email= mail.from.name=BG-billing server mail.to.email= mail.to.name= mail.encoding=windows-1251 #параметры SMTP авторизации #mail.smtp.user= #mail.smtp.pswd= #проверка уникальности адреса договора при вводе - 1, 0 - не проверять address.unique.check=1 #формат адреса (доступен также параметр ${comment} - комментарий параметра) addrs.format=(${index})(, ${city})(, ${area})(, ${quarter})(, ${street})(, д. ${house})(, др. ${frac})(, кв. ${flat})( ${room})(, ${pod} под.)(, ${floor} эт.) #заголовок и адрес к шаблону карточки (доступны в свойствах договора) contractcard.1=card_inet.xsl:Карта регистрации contractcard.2=dog_test_inet.xsl:Договор contractcard.3=nar_inet.xsl:Наряд contractcard.4=contract.xsl:Контракт #логирование вызовов функций BGBS (1-логировать, 0-нет) #логируются выводы print, error и ошибки, после установки перезапустить BGBillingServer log.function.process=1 #вывод в server.log XML возвращаемых клиенту в режиме DEBUG - 1 server.response.debug=0 ################## # опции BGSecure # ################## #проверка прав, 0 - не проверять bgsecure.check=1 #логирование действий в журнале событий, 0 - не логировать bgsecure.log=1 ################################ # опции WEB интерфейса клиента # ################################ # режим авторизации для доступа к WEB статистике кодмодуля:режим;код модуля 1:режим # модуль 0 - ядро # режим 0 - не разрешена, 1 - FORM web.auth.modes=0:1;11:1 #добавление в XML на странице статистике детальной информации по договору - 1 web.add.contract=0 #опции для отладки #вывод в server.log XML перед сборкой странички статистики в режиме DEBUG - 1 web.response.debug=0 #странице WEB авторизации web.auth.page=auth.html #страница куда пересылать при выходе с WEB статистики web.exit.redirect=about:blank #максимально количество запросов для договора на сервер статистики в день, 0 - не ограничено web.max.day.request.count=0 #кэширование XSLT шаблонов в HTML режиме, 1 - включить (ускорение отображения страниц) web.xslt.cache=0 #логирование web-запросов пользователя (web-интерфейс) webquery.log=1 #длина пароля договора для доступа к статистике contract.passw.down=5 contract.passw.up=10 #только цифры в пароле (режим необходим при использовании IVR-модуля card) #passw.content=onlydigit 2. Точно bgbilling, я его (хранилище) создал при установке сервер, а о возможности изменения пароля на хранилище узнал недавно. Эта возможность у вас почему-то не задокументированна. 3. После перезагрузки сервера начались следующие проблемы(хотя они сами посебе пропали) http://www.bgbilling.ru/forum/viewtopic.php?p=9625 |
Автор: | mrustik [ 18 ноя 2008, 09:03 ] |
Заголовок сообщения: | |
после ввода команды keytool -list -keystore .keystore -storepass bgbilling получилось Keystore type: JKS Keystore provider: SUN Your keystore contains 1 entry bgbilling, 29.05.2008, PrivateKeyEntry, Certificate fingerprint (MD5): 2B:70:46:27:E5:D5:75:88:E1:82:31:1A:CE:DC:C0:75 |
Автор: | mrustik [ 19 ноя 2008, 09:18 ] |
Заголовок сообщения: | |
Up |
Автор: | mrustik [ 24 ноя 2008, 10:35 ] |
Заголовок сообщения: | |
Up |
Автор: | mrustik [ 01 дек 2008, 09:49 ] |
Заголовок сообщения: | |
Up |
Автор: | mrustik [ 02 дек 2008, 10:00 ] |
Заголовок сообщения: | |
Up |
Автор: | Amir [ 03 дек 2008, 17:44 ] |
Заголовок сообщения: | |
Цитата: keystore.password =1234567
у вас ключ в конфиге с пробелом |
Автор: | mrustik [ 04 дек 2008, 12:44 ] |
Заголовок сообщения: | |
вроде заработало, в конфиге не видно пробела. |
Страница 1 из 1 | Часовой пояс: UTC + 5 часов [ Летнее время ] |
Powered by phpBB® Forum Software © phpBB Group http://www.phpbb.com/ |